LOS ANGELES COUNTY, Calif. – Two people, including an innocent cyclist, were killed in separate crashes involving school buses in Los Angeles County Friday morning.
The first crash happened in Lancaster around 7 a.m. on Avenue M, east of 20th Street.
According to the LA County Sheriff’s Department, a gray SUV was heading east on Avenue M, when the driver veered into oncoming traffic, hitting the school bus “nearly head-on.” Detectives are still working to figure out why the driver strayed into the other lane.…
